The Winter Wonderland of Sicily

       I got a call from my friend Maximo wanting me to go with him and a few buddies up to an area called Nebrody.  "It's in the mountains and this time of year there is lots of snow" he says.  I hop in the Bronco and we take off.  Here are the photos of that day.

We drove most of the day and got stuck only when Maximo would stop on an incline to see if we were all following...  He stopped a few times.  As we slid off the road into deeper snow I was able to use my winch and snatch block to do some creative winching.   Half way up the road we saw two wild boars rooting through the snow looking for lunch.  We had all stopped at a momma and poppa store earlier for some grub and we ate at the summit with a great view while Cicio tried to dry out his wet feet in the fire.

  Night was on it's way so we drove down and decided to try our luck at climbing a trail near my house up on Mt. Etna.  Next stop Etna!  As we blazed up the trail it quickly became way to steep and deep for us to continue.  We took a few photos and called it a night.
